Abstract;In this paper, was proposed a frequency error correction system capable of corresponding also to multivalue demodulation system such as PSK (phase shift keying, QAM (quadrature amplitude modulation), and so on, under realizing features near maximum ratio synthetic diversity, by carrying out iterative demodulation.
